Ducati Monster description

Selling my iconic 2004 Ducati Monster 620 Dark. 

The bike runs amazing, sounds great, turns head and of course has the classic Ducati tank dent (has been down once at very low speed). Its a classic, the 620 is the perfect entry to the Monster family. Easy to maintain, it is the lightest and easiest handling Ducati. I use as my daily ride.
Lower price as due for a service and will need new tires soon. Still a lot of life left in this beauty.

I have the title, card and space red key

Ducati CEO Domenicali Talks 899 Panigale, Audi and MotoGP Performance

Thu, 12 Sep 2013

Following the debut of the new 899 Panigale during Audi‘s presentation at the Frankfurt Motor Show, Ducati held a separate, smaller press conference with the motorcycle press at its headquarters in Bologna, Italy, to discuss the new “Supermid” sportbike and the company’s Chief Executive Officer Claudio Domenicali discussed the state of the company after a year under its new ownership. “Audi is a stakeholder who wishes to be involved in the technical development of the company and to focus its efforts on product development. Now, a year after the acquisition, it is time to take stock of the initial results and look to the future with a positive and proactive attitude,” says Domenicali.  “Ducati achieved record sales in 2011 and again in 2012 when over 44,000 motorcycles were delivered to customers.
